Delana Kissinger Dies After Louisville, Kentucky Auto Accident

Delana Kissinger, age 54, died Tuesday after being severely injured in a Louisville, Kentucky car crash. Ms. Kissinger resided on the 1500 block of Raydale Drive. She had been driving northbound on Robbs Lane, near the Outer Loop when a southbound vehicle crossed into Ms. Kissinger’s lane of traffic and caused the Kentucky car crash. Police reports indicate that the southbound vehicle may have been traveling at a high rate of speed. Delana Kissinger was taken from the scene of the accident to UL Hospital to be treated for multiple blunt force injures. She died around 11;30 p.m. from those injures. There was a passenger in Ms. Kissinger’s vehicle who was also treated for injures from this collision.
